Seaside town residents get in a flap over gulls' mess
Daily Express
|April 25, 2025
THOUSANDS of protected gulls are making a stinking mess of a town after flocking back there from two offshore “hotels” where they have been encouraged to breed.
Residents and shopkeepers are fighting a losing battle, scrubbing the droppings off buildings and pavements amid the onslaught of kittiwakes in Lowestoft, Suffolk.
